Location

The Bruntsfield Hotel is located a short walk from Edinburgh city centre, close to attractions within the UNESCO World Heritage Site. Guests enjoy direct views across Bruntsfield Links Park and the Meadows Park. The hotel offers parking and electric vehicle charging points for convenience.

Dining

The hotel features The Neighbourhood Kitchen, Bar & Garden, which serves a selection of homemade dishes utilizing high-quality Scottish ingredients. Guests can enjoy a renowned Scottish breakfast, weekend lunches, and diverse dinner options including pastas and pizzas. The pet-friendly garden, with individual heaters for each booth, allows for dining in a relaxed outdoor setting.

Rooms

The Bruntsfield Hotel offers a variety of accommodations, including standard, superior, and family rooms, ensuring options for all types of travelers. Family rooms are designed to comfortably accommodate up to four guests. The unique four-poster bedrooms deliver a distinctive charm within the townhouse.

Business Facilities

The hotel provides versatile meeting spaces, including the Cardoon Suite, which accommodates up to 80 delegates and includes direct access to a secluded garden terrace. Meeting packages include essential amenities such as a digital projector, stationary, and refreshments. A portion of the delegate rate goes to support Invisible Cities, a social enterprise.

Pet-Friendly and Family Amenities

The Bruntsfield Hotel welcomes pets in specific areas, making it easy for travelers to bring their furry companions. Families can take advantage of inter-connecting rooms and child-friendly dining options available at The Neighbourhood. The hotel prioritizes a family-oriented experience with various amenities designed to accommodate all ages.

Property information and rules
Check-in
from 15:00-23:59
Check-out
until 11 am
Guest Parking
Private parking is possible on site at GBP 12.50 per day.
Internet
Wireless internet is available in for free.
Breakfast
A full breakfast is served at the price of GBP15.50 per person per day. 
Pets
Pets are allowed on request.
Year renovated:
2007
Number of rooms:
72
Former name
BEST WESTERN PLUS Bruntsfield

Questions of the users
About Ja The Bruntsfield - Edinburgh
Are there parking options available near the hotel if on-site parking is full?
10 December 2024
Bruntsfield Place provides metered on-street parking, available from 8:00 AM to 6:30 PM, with a maximum stay of 2 hours.
Can interconnecting rooms be booked for a family visit with children?
25 November 2024
Interconnecting rooms can be arranged by booking a Classic double and an Executive twin. Be sure to specify the need for interconnection when making your reservation.
What is the likelihood of securing a parking spot at the hotel?
15 January 2025
As the hotel offers only 22 parking spaces for its 72 bedrooms, availability is limited and operates on a first-come, first-served basis.
Is it possible to bring caged birds to the hotel?
2 February 2025
Only dogs and assistance dogs are permitted at the hotel; other animals, including caged birds, are unfortunately not allowed.
Will I find a hairdryer in my room?
18 March 2025
All guest bedrooms are equipped with hairdryers for your convenience.
Are debit cards accepted for payments at the hotel?
7 April 2025
All major credit and debit cards are accepted for transactions.
Is there a fee for bringing a service dog?
20 February 2025
No pet fee applies for guide or assistance dogs. These dogs should remain supervised and on a lead while in the hotel.
What is the daily charge for parking at the hotel?
12 March 2025
Parking is available at a cost of £12.50 per day, based on the availability of limited spaces.
Are breakfast options available, or are all meals room-only?
29 January 2025
The hotel provides both Bed & Breakfast and Room Only options for guests.
What transportation options are available to the city center from the hotel?
6 May 2025
The hotel is conveniently located on a main bus route, with services such as the number 11 and 16 connecting directly to the city center.
